WebSteyning is a pleasant little market town just under the South Downs northern escarpment. Most of the trails are open downland dual track, mostly of hard pack chalk and flint, but with some loose material overlain in places. Grip is generally excellent in dry conditions, but can be treacherously slippery when damp or wet. WebDevil’s Dyke Pub - great views – YHA Truleigh Hill Loop from Bramber. Difficult. 01:54. 25.6 km. WebThe Steyning Line was a railway branch line that connected the West Sussex market town of Horsham with the port of Shoreham-by-Sea, with connections to Brighton.It was built by the London, Brighton and South Coast Railway, and opened in 1861.It was 20 miles (32 km) in length. Free shipping for many products! industrial hi tech sheeting contractors ltdWebSteyning 1 : 31680 This plan presents a seciton of the South Downs coastline from Littlehampton at the bottom left to Old Shoreham at bottom right. The meandering River Arun forms the left-hand boundary. Produced against the background of the Napoleonic Wars, the drawing shows the vulnerable south coast heavily defended against invasion. industrial hitch vs standard hitch
